CI runs for the Quillmark relevance-tuning suite may fail if your plugin overrides the default analyzer chain without re-registering the synonym filter. The scoring snapshot tests compare against baselines generated on the Farlane cluster, so local passes can still break in CI. Re-run the tuning job with snapshots pinned before filing an issue. Include the token from the failed run below.

build token for kagup-kagug: htk9_1a9a918d7

## Runbook: Retention Sweeper (Plugin Integration)

The Hollowell retention sweeper runs nightly and purges records past their configured TTL. Plugins that register custom record types must declare a retention policy, or the sweeper skips them and logs a warning. To test sweeps against the sandbox dataset, call the sweeper's dry-run endpoint on the Marrow staging cluster; it reports what would be deleted without removing anything. Authenticate these calls against the internal sweeper service with the key below.

app token of bahaf-tajeg = zpat23_SjjsllwiLmXbtS65veZaV47

Heads up, plugin folks: the Clipforge transcode farm is moving to signed plugin bundles starting with release 4.2. Build your plugin as usual, run `forgekit pack`, and push to the staging ring first — prod rejects anything unsigned. Test against the Varnholt sample reels before submitting. Sign your bundle with the key shown below:

deploy key for tadug-tafog: bky3_hqi

Subject: Key rotation — Tidewatch widget backend

Hi folks, quick heads-up for whoever's on call this week: we rotated the service key the Tidewatch tide-table widget uses to pull predictions from the Moonpull forecast service. The old key dies Friday at noon. If the widget starts showing stale tables, swap in the new key and redeploy. Here's the replacement key for the on-call config.

service key, kawig-hahaf: zpat4_JspY